Tandem two-seat RV — fighter-style front/back seating, the most aerobatic-friendly RV, ~190 kt on a 180-200 hp Lycoming. Popular for sport aerobatics and the "warbird-feel" tandem layout.

Van's RV-8 Specifications
Model specThe Van's RV-8 is a 2-seat experimental with a cruise speed of 173 kt (320 km/h), a range of 686–700 nm (1,270–1,296 km), and a useful load of 640–650 lbs (290–295 kg).

Van's RV-8 Safety Record
Across all RV-8 variants, 5 NTSB-recorded events are on file from 2019–2026. As with any aircraft, most outcomes depend on pilot training, maintenance and operating conditions rather than the airframe itself.
